Ramen in kanji - Zangyo-Ninja

A food that is similar to Chinese noodle dishes but has been transformed uniquely in Japan. Many shops offering tonkotsu ramen (noodle with a thick broth made from boiling pork bones) including Hakata ramen shops prepare takanazuke stir-fried in oil with red pepper to top ramen with.

karate in kanji - Zangyo-Ninja

a traditional Japanese system of unarmed combat. An Okinawan martial art involving primarily punching and kicking, but additionally, advanced throws, arm bars, grappling and all means of fighting.

miso soup (polite) in Kanji - Zangyo-Ninja

A traditional Japanese soup consisting of a stock called “dashi” into which softened miso paste is mixed. And old style and noble word. It has been used by women since ancient times as a wife’s word. Japanese says o-mi-o-tsuke.
